Today, we are going to be starting a series that is going to take us basically the whole year to go through. I know that may sound overwhleming, but I can assure you that it will be a good time. You see, I think it is extremely important for us to understand our Bible and how it works. We need to know who wrote it, why they wrote it, when they wrote it, and in what form they wrote it. So I figured that, instead of trying to explain the entire Bible, book-by-book, or just spending time on a single book, we should take a cruise through the entire biblical story.
By doing this, we will see how the world was created and why we as humans were created. We will understand why the world is the way it is, and what we are supposed to do about it. And we will be able to hope for the future and all that is in store for all of Creation.
